Design and Implementation of a Parallel Simulation Environment for Network Research and Education

Wang, Bin
Dept. of Computer Science and Engineering
Wright State University  

Summary
The Cluster will be used to develop and demonstrate an efficient (in terms of simulation speedup) and user friendly parallel network simulation environment for the state-of-the-art network research and higher education. The parallel simulation run time infrastructure developed will intelligently incorporate the idiosyncrasies of networks and can take advantage of the computational power and physical memory offered by PC clusters. It will also provide a good teaching tool to be used by undergraduate and graduate students at Wright State University and other institutions in their introductory and advanced communication network courses for the education of a generation of information technology work-force. We intend to make the technology and software developed in the project accessible to OSC, industrial organizations, and other academic institutions.
